The table below prov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ies requiring Cucumber skills. It includes a benchmarking guide to the annual salaries offered in vacancies that cited Cucumber over the 6 months leading up to 31 May 2025, comparing them to the same period in the previous two years.

6 months to
31 May 2025
Same period 2024 Same period 2023
Rank 354 640 420
Rank change year-on-year +286 -220 -73
Permanent jobs citing Cucumber 400 273 725
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in the UK 0.72% 0.26% 0.76%
As % of the Development Applications category 6.64% 2.87% 5.39%
Number of salaries quoted 56 196 505
10th Percentile £46,740 £41,250 £42,544
25th Percentile £50,000 £52,500 £50,000
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£60,000 £68,750 £65,351
Median % change year-on-year -12.73% +5.20% +0.54%
75th Percentile £86,257 £95,000 £92,500
90th Percentile £129,088 £112,500 £101,185
UK excluding London median annual salary £58,750 £60,000 £59,000
% change year-on-year -2.08% +1.69% +12.38%
